Output 83500d9b29c50178f4274db5eca621a93ff5797481de7a3382690a9b1373640c:1

value
40260
script pubkey
OP_0 OP_PUSHBYTES_20 fd3e5bf59e0caff893010833f16058a9cb349b10
address
bc1ql5l9hav7pjhl3ycppqelzczc489nfxcsydx3jl
transaction
83500d9b29c50178f4274db5eca621a93ff5797481de7a3382690a9b1373640c
confirmations
99841
spent
true